Position Summary

The Senior Manager, Facilities – Workplace Services plays a key role in supporting corporate projects and business initiatives by ensuring the effective operation, stewardship, and continuous improvement of Aetna’s corporate facilities. You will partner closely with internal stakeholders to provide guidance, insight, and decision support related to facilities operations, capital planning, and infrastructure needs, ensuring alignment with organizational goals and priorities.

You will be responsible for oversight of administrative facilities supporting the Aetna Corporate Property, providing engineering review and technical support for new facilities, renovations, and critical infrastructure projects. You will manage multi‑million‑dollar operating and capital budgets across owned and leased facilities and ensures facilities services are delivered safely, efficiently, and in compliance with applicable regulations.

You will also lead and develop a small team of facilities professionals, promoting effective communication, collaboration, and strong working relationships with cross‑functional partners. You will oversee facility services and communications in alignment with established processes, procedures, and KPIs to support high levels of customer satisfaction and operational performance.

Key Responsibilities

  • Oversees day‑to‑day operations of assigned corporate and administrative facilities, ensuring safe, reliable, and compliant building operations.
  • Develops, manages, and executes operating and capital budgets aligned with divisional goals; provides regular financial reporting, tracks variances, and supports recovery plans within established targets.
  • Supports development and approval of annual capital plans, including infrastructure upgrades and building modifications to maintain long‑term facility functionality.
  • Provides engineering review and technical support for new facilities, renovations, and existing critical projects.
  • Conducts facility assessments—including mechanical systems, building envelope, interiors, and energy performance—and develops recommendations for improvements.
  • Drives cost savings and efficiency improvements through effective vendor utilization, preferred supplier programs, and operational enhancements.
  • Partners with procurement to define scope of work, coordinate supplier walk‑throughs, and manage vendor and contractor performance at the property level.
  • Ensures compliance with portfolio standards and applicable local, state, and federal laws and regulations related to corporate facility operations.
  • Maintains accurate and timely facilities data across systems supporting operational processes, metrics, and reporting.
  • Leads and develops staff, fostering engagement, accountability, and effective collaboration with cross‑functional teams.
  • Develops and implements programs, processes, and initiatives that reduce short‑ and long‑term operating costs while improving productivity, asset performance, and longevity.
